Does this opportunity interest you?
Western National is seeking a CL Audit Associate to join our team!
The individual in this role will have the opportunity to provide administrative support for the Commercial Lines, Loss Control, and Premium Audit teams by coordinating workflows, supporting underwriting operations, and delivering exceptional service to both internal and external customers.
What are the responsibilities and opportunities of this role?
- Reviews premium audit requests and assigns them to the appropriate audit vendors in accordance with established guidelines.
- Processes final premium audit results and ensures all required information is complete and accurate for audit processing.
- Reviews and assigns underwriting loss control requests for new business quotes, renewals, high loss ratio accounts, and service accounts.
- Receives incoming loss control reports, follows company guidelines, and issues recommendation letters, as needed.
- Verifies that information collected and reported by auditors meets established quality and compliance standards.
- Researches issues, gathers relevant information, and supports the resolution of routine underwriting and audit questions.
- Makes decisions related to routine activities and escalates more complex issues as appropriate.
- Applies knowledge to resolve problems of limited scope and recommends solutions for more complex situations.
- Delivers exceptional customer service by responding promptly to phone and email inquiries, setting appropriate expectations, and ensuring commitments are met.
- Collaborates effectively with underwriting, loss control, premium audit, and other internal teams to support business operations.
- Performs special projects and other duties as assigned.
